Towards Lightweight, Adaptive and Attribute-Aware Multi-Aspect Controllable Text Generation with Large Language Models

多方面可控文本生成旨在从多个属性维度控制生成内容,是自然语言处理中复杂但强大的任务。监督微调方法因简单高效被广泛采用,但仍存在局限:低秩适应(LoRA)仅微调少量参数,控制效果不佳;全量微调(FFT)需大量计算资源且易过拟合,尤其在数据有限时。此外,现有工作通常仅使用单方面标注数据训练模型,导致数据分布不一致,准确生成特定属性文本仍具挑战,需强属性感知能力。为此,本文提出一种轻量、自适应且属性感知的多方面可控文本生成框架。该框架能根据数据不同方面动态调整模型参数,实现跨多方面的可控生成,优化整体性能。实验表明,该框架优于多个强基线,达到当前最优水平,对数据分布差异有良好适应性,且在属性感知上更精准。

Multi-aspect controllable text generation aims to control text generation in attributes from multiple aspects, making it a complex but powerful task in natural language processing. Supervised fine-tuning methods are often employed for this task due to their simplicity and effectiveness. However, they still have some limitations: low rank adaptation (LoRA) only fine-tunes a few parameters and has suboptimal control effects, while full fine-tuning (FFT) requires significant computational resources and is susceptible to overfitting, particularly when data is limited. Moreover, existing works typically train multi-aspect controllable text generation models using only single-aspect annotated data, which results in discrepancies in data distribution; at the same time, accurately generating text with specific attributes is a challenge that requires strong attribute-aware capabilities. To address these limitations, we propose a lightweight, adaptive and attribute-aware framework for multi-aspect controllable text generation. Our framework can dynamically adjust model parameters according to different aspects of data to achieve controllable text generation, aiming to optimize performance across multiple aspects. Experimental results show that our framework outperforms other strong baselines, achieves state-of-the-art performance, adapts well to data discrepancies, and is more accurate in attribute perception.
